Chef Ramsay branded ‘stupid’
Published: 29/08/2008
SIR Paul McCartney has criticised Gordon Ramsay – calling the TV chef “stupid”.
Ramsay, 41, has angered the ex-Beatle, 66, with his outspoken comments against vegetarians.
The foul-mouthed chef has said he could not tolerate it if one of his three daughters came home with a vegetarian boyfriend.
Kitchen Nightmares star Ramsay said recently: “If one of my daughters’ boyfriends turns out to be vegetarian I swear to God I’d never forgive them.”
In another tirade, he said: “My biggest nightmare would be if the kids ever came up to me and said ‘dad, I’m a vegetarian’. Then I would sit them on the fence and electrocute them.”
Sir Paul, who has not eaten meat for 30 years, said: “I think it’s a case of live and let live.
“I will talk to people about the advantages of vegetarianism and it will upset me if we’ve had a good conversation and they turn around and say something stupid.
“I just read a quote from Gordon Ramsay . . . ‘If my daughter ever grew up and married a vegetarian, I’d never forgive her.’
“But even that I would forgive because it’s not my affair, it’s not up to me if he talks stupid or not.”
